Maintenance Technician - Electrical & Instrument M/F
Contract: Fixed-term contract
Hours: Full time
Location: Doha, Qatar
Job PurposeTo optimize the reliability and availability of equipment within the area of responsibility through completing maintenance activities in accordance with NOC approved operation procedures, guidelines, legislative requirements and industry best practice.
Responsibilities- Identify opportunities and champion initiatives that enable maximum production and injection output within the parameters of environmental compliance and process safety.
- Provide the Team Lead with regular reports with analysis and comment on performance and results. Be held accountable for the area of responsibility.
- Establish and maintain effective relationships with external parties, functional teams and corporate groups as required to meet NOC strategic business and operational objectives.
- Contribute to improvements, development and implementation of department activities, processes and procedures.
- Complete safe and efficient replacement and repair activities in case of failure or malfunction ensuring quick restoration; troubleshoot malfunctions and take corrective actions as necessary.
- Optimize production and uptime when executing maintenance activities which require shutdown/isolation or equipment.
- Conduct diagnostic tests and report repetitive equipment failures.
- Prepare adequate documentation and reporting for offshore management consideration regarding wrong design, poor workmanship, non-compliance to NOC standards; take appropriate action within level of authority.
- Contribute to identifying improvements to planned maintenance routines.
- Minimum higher secondary school education.
- Three‑year technical diploma (HNC, HND, or equivalent) in electrical or instrumentation.
- Minimum 10 years of experience, including at least 5 years offshore working on-field equipment in diversified oil & gas processing or petrochemical plants.
- Equal expertise in electrical and instrumentation disciplines.
- Previous experience as an Isolation Authority and Area Authority.
- Ability to read and interpret P&.
- Strong knowledge of electrical safety and instrumentation standards; familiar with isolation procedures and offshore safety protocols.
- Fit to work (required authorisation).
English (C–Professional working proficiency)
BenefitsLong‑term contract with attractive daily rate, insurance coverage, transportation and expat standard accommodation.
